Design And Realization Of High Accurate Measurement Algorithm And System On Flexographic Plate Dot

Flexography,supported by national policy,is not only the environmental excellent printing method,but also an important means for flexible package in printing market.However,it is difficult to measure ratio of dot area directly because of the complexity of printing plate material and dot in control of flexography,which restricts the realization refined flexographic printing.Therefore,technology of direct measurement of flexographic plate becomes the key in study of flexography.This thesis systematically reviewed the study of dot detection home and abroad and analyzed current situation of dot detection technology so that a technology of image segmentation is proposed to solve the difficulty of dot reorganization in flexographic plate dot detection according to particularity of flexographic plate dot.This technology segments the dot region and based region in image of flexographic plate through calculation of threshold.Furthermore,it measures ratio of flexographic plate dot area by means of calculation of connected domain area in segmented image.The technology realizes a high accurate computational measurement for flexographic plate dot.Besides,a detective system based on Android mobile plate is established for it.This dot detection equipment is both smart and portable,which breaks the technique block abroad and promotes it in China.It processes theoretical value and engineering value for a high precise development of flexography industry.
